The Study And Exploration Of High Vocational Physics Experiment Teaching Innovation

The thesis takes physics experiment teaching as the study object in W College, starting from the content of high vocational education. On the basis of analyzing the modes of high vocational education and the situation s of high vocational physics experiment both at home and abroad , surveying students of different majors of all the three grades in this college around many questions like the physical experimental basis, modes and experimental evaluation, etc. At the same time, teachers are questioned and interviewed around which knowledge points concerned and experimental teachers'professional levels. In this way, it is learned that students have a poor experimental foundation in the physical experimental teaching, and commonly, physics teachers are lack of practice and little professional knowledge is involved in the physics experiments. Pointing to the problems existing in the experimental teaching, an open experimental teaching mode is put forward, the specialization of physics experimental teachers is strengthened and the exploration of"modularization and specialization"of physics experiments is done. Simultaneously, some designing experimental methods are discovered to improve the teaching quality of physics experiment, laying a good foundation for students vocational learning in this college, and thus improve the students'practical ability.The emphasis of the thesis is put on the exploration of"modularization and specialization of physics experiments", and combines physics knowledge concerned in professional subjects, then conducts the teaching analysis based on the case of Hall effect and its applications, illustrating the teaching method of penetrating relative vocational knowledge in the process of experiments. It is recognized that it is really necessary to penetrate relative knowledge in the physics experiments. We should strengthen the exploration of"modularization and specialization of physics experiments", develop designing experiments in many ranges, and speed up the"specialization"of experimental teachers. Hence, we can improve the comprehensive qualities of the students and the specialization levels of the teachers, and physics experimental teaching can exert a better role in the training of high quality talents.
